Ingredients Notes

The magic of Big Boy’s Fresh Strawberry Pie lies in its simple, high-quality ingredients. Each one plays a crucial role in achieving that iconic taste and texture.
Fresh strawberries are the star of the show. Choose ripe, firm, and bright red berries for the best flavor and appearance. If possible, buy local strawberries when they’re in season for a natural sweetness that enhances the pie.
A pre-baked pie crust provides the perfect crispy base for the juicy filling. You can use a store-bought crust for convenience, but a homemade buttery crust takes this pie to the next level.
Strawberry gelatin is the secret to the glossy, beautifully set glaze. It intensifies the strawberry flavor and gives the pie its signature vibrant red color.
Cornstarch and sugar work together to thicken the glaze, giving it just the right consistency to coat the strawberries while remaining light and fresh.
You’ll also need water and a bit of lemon juice, which help balance the sweetness and add a touch of brightness to the glaze.
How To Make This Big Boy’s Fresh Strawberry Pie

Making Big Boy’s Fresh Strawberry Pie is easier than you might think. Let’s break it down step by step.
Start by preparing your pie crust. If you’re using a store-bought crust, bake it according to the package directions and let it cool completely. If making from scratch, roll out the dough, fit it into a pie pan, and blind-bake it until golden and crisp.
While the crust cools, prepare the glaze. In a saucepan over medium heat, whisk together sugar, cornstarch, and water until smooth. Bring the mixture to a boil, stirring constantly, until it thickens into a glossy, translucent sauce. Remove from heat and stir in the strawberry gelatin until fully dissolved.
Next, prep your strawberries. Wash, hull, and slice them if desired. Arrange them in the cooled pie crust, piling them high to create a generous filling.
Pour the warm glaze over the strawberries, ensuring they’re evenly coated. The glaze will settle between the berries, giving them a luscious, shiny finish.
Let the pie chill in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ours, or until the filling is fully set. This step ensures that each slice holds together beautifully when served.
Storage Options
To keep your Big Boy’s Fresh Strawberry Pie tasting its best, store it properly.
Cover the pie loosely with plastic wrap and refrigerate for up to 3 days. The crust may soften slightly over time, but the flavor remains delicious.
If you need to make it ahead, prepare the crust and glaze separately. Assemble the pie a few hours before serving for the freshest texture.
Freezing is not recommended, as the gelatin-based filling doesn’t hold up well when thawed, resulting in a watery texture.
Variations and Substitutions
One of the best things about this pie is how adaptable it is. Here are a few ways to switch it up.
For a lighter version, substitute sugar with a sugar alternative and use sugar-free strawberry gelatin.
Want a twist on the classic? Try using mixed berries like raspberries and blueberries alongside strawberries for a more colorful pie.
If you’re looking for a richer flavor, consider adding a cream cheese layer to the crust before adding the strawberries. Just blend cream cheese with powdered sugar and spread it on the crust before assembling.
For an extra hint of citrus, stir a little orange zest into the glaze for a fresh, tangy contrast.

Ingredients
- 1 pre-baked 9-inch pie crust
- 1 quart fresh strawberries, hulled
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 3 tablespoons cornstarch
- 1 cup water
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 package (3 oz) strawberry gelatin
- Whipped cream (optional, for serving)
Instructions
- Arrange fresh strawberries in the pre-baked pie crust.
- In a saucepan, mix sugar, cornstarch, and water. Cook over medium heat, stirring until thickened.
- Remove from heat and stir in lemon juice and strawberry gelatin until dissolved.
- Pour the glaze over the strawberries, coating them evenly.
- Refrigerate for at least 2-3 hours until set.
- Serve chilled with whipped cream, if desired.
